Department of Pharmaceuticals has directed authorities to ensure that all drugs and medical devices manufacturing plants should be upgraded to world-class standards over the next three years.

The directive was issued by Union Minister for Chemicals & Fertilizers, Shri Jagat Prakash Nadda along with MoS (Chemicals & Fertilizers), Ms. Anupriya Patel in a review meeting presided by them on Saturday. 

The officials presented a detailed overview of the Pharma and MediTech sector and gave a detailed presentation on the activities of the Department including the regulatory framework and the schemes implemented by the Department.

Minister emphasized the need to focus on the PM’s vision of Viksit Bharat @ 2047 and also reviewed the Five-Year Agenda and the 100-day Action Plan.  The Five Year Plan would focus on enhancing drug security, Aatmanirbharta in medical devices, expansion of the Jan Aushadhi Scheme, and making medicines and treatments affordable for the citizens.

Union Minister also directed that quality should receive a renewed focus and that all drugs and medical devices manufacturing plants should be upgraded to world-class standards over the next three years.
